    Default Re: Cannot use pics from ebay on this forum?

    You can't 'copy' a pic, but the print screen function behaves as if you are by attaching the screen capture to the 'clipboard'.

    Try this, in Chrome enlarge the pic in ebay, then right click on the enlarged photo and click 'view page source'. In the page that appears you will see text and links, one of the links will end in .JPG or .jpeg etc, click this and it will take you to the picture which you will be able to 'save as', as normal. It's easier and faster than it sounds.
